A Regal Vision: Duccio’s Prophet Solomon
Duccio di Buoninsegna's “The Prophet Solomon” from the predella of the Maestà altarpiece is a captivating glimpse into 14th-century Sienese artistry. This panel, originally part of a monumental work commissioned for Siena Cathedral between 1308 and 1311, transcends mere religious depiction; it’s a masterful study in regal authority, musicality, and the burgeoning naturalism that would define Italian painting.
Historical & Artistic Context
The Maestà was revolutionary for its time. Duccio moved away from the rigid Byzantine conventions prevalent in Italy, infusing his work with a new sense of human emotion and spatial awareness. The predella panels, including “The Prophet Solomon,” served as narrative complements to the central image of the Virgin Mary enthroned. These smaller scenes offered moments of storytelling and allowed Duccio to explore diverse subjects within a unified artistic vision. Duccio’s work bridged the gap between the Byzantine past and the Gothic future, influencing generations of artists including Simone Martini and the Lorenzetti brothers.
Decoding Solomon's Court: Style & Symbolism
- Composition: The panel centers on King Solomon, seated majestically upon his throne. He is not alone; a vibrant court surrounds him – musicians playing instruments and dancers in dynamic poses. This bustling scene conveys the wealth, power, and cultural flourishing associated with Solomon’s reign.
- Technique: Executed in tempera and gold leaf on wood panel, Duccio's technique is characterized by meticulous detail and a rich color palette. The use of gold creates an ethereal glow, emphasizing the sacred nature of the subject while simultaneously highlighting Solomon’s earthly power.
- Symbolism: Solomon, renowned for his wisdom and just rule, represents divine authority on Earth. The musicians and dancers symbolize harmony and prosperity under his leadership. The scroll he holds likely alludes to his authorship of the Book of Proverbs or Song of Solomon, further emphasizing his intellectual and spiritual gifts.
